Subject: ARM: dts: Adjust moxart IRQ controller and flags
From: Linus Walleij <linus.walleij@linaro.org>
[ Upstream commit c2a736b698008d296c5010ec39077eeb5796109f ]
The moxart interrupt line flags were not respected in previous
driver: instead of assigning them per-consumer, a fixes mask
was set in the controller.
With the migration to a standard Faraday driver we need to
set up and handle the consumer flags correctly. Also remove
the Moxart-specific flags when switching to using real consumer
flags.
Extend the register window to 0x100 bytes as we may have a few
more registers in there and it doesn't hurt.
